Transaction 2682d79680facb6f4a6fb8762734bbf3f495294c94f836a577490f311540f07e
1 Input
1 Output
-
2682d79680facb6f4a6fb8762734bbf3f495294c94f836a577490f311540f07e:0
- value
- 27228102
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70e6ddfef67242fe31fcc46e967b10f90d66c731 OP_EQUAL
- address
- 3ByzAxhGyHV3yC75tf64bDuSY5n9muvbQ9